Using anti hypertensives should be done carefully. I am afraid your doctor takes many things into consideration (history, medical history) before these drugs are taken.
Zebeta has many side effects such as swelling, exertion, abnormal heart beats, tiredness and nervousness.
Zebeta paradoxically has very potent and efficient effects on arrhythmia (abnormal heart beats).
I would suggest you comply with the directives of your doctor. Life style changes like low fat diet, low dose Aspirin, exercise, XXXXXXX fruit and vegetable diet could be very helpful. It is important that you also report any side effects in case you experience any.
